[LON-CAPA-cvs] cvs: loncom /interface londocs.pm
www
lon-capa-cvs@mail.lon-capa.org
Wed, 16 Oct 2002 20:18:19 -0000
www Wed Oct 16 16:18:19 2002 EDT
Modified files:
/loncom/interface londocs.pm
Log:
Lists update version file
Index: loncom/interface/londocs.pm
diff -u loncom/interface/londocs.pm:1.29 loncom/interface/londocs.pm:1.30
--- loncom/interface/londocs.pm:1.29 Wed Oct 16 15:15:55 2002
+++ loncom/interface/londocs.pm Wed Oct 16 16:18:19 2002
@@ -1,7 +1,7 @@
# The LearningOnline Network
# Documents
#
-# $Id: londocs.pm,v 1.29 2002/10/16 19:15:55 www Exp $
+# $Id: londocs.pm,v 1.30 2002/10/16 20:18:19 www Exp $
#
# Copyright Michigan State University Board of Trustees
#
@@ -294,6 +294,8 @@
$r->print('<html><head><title>Verify Content</title></head>'.
&Apache::loncommon::bodytag('Verify Course Documents'));
$hashtied=0;
+ undef %alreadyseen;
+ %alreadyseen=();
&tiehash();
foreach (keys %hash) {
if (($_=~/^src\_(.+)$/) && (!$alreadyseen{$hash{$_}})) {
@@ -306,7 +308,13 @@
&Apache::loncommon::bodytag('Check Course Document Versions'));
$hashtied=0;
&tiehash();
-
+ my %changes=&Apache::lonnet::dump
+ ('versionupdate',$ENV{'course.'.$ENV{'request.course.id'}.'.domain'},
+ $ENV{'course.'.$ENV{'request.course.id'}.'.num'});
+ foreach (keys %changes) {
+ $r->print('<br /><a href="'.$_.'" target="cat">'.$_.'</a> - '.
+ localtime($changes{$_}));
+ }
&untiehash();
} else {
# is this a standard course?